




I recently tested the Lying Pillow to see if its unique prone-sleeping design could actually solve the neck strain often associated with stomach sleeping. Over the course of a week, I used the pillow for both casual lounging and full night sleep cycles to evaluate its comfort levels.
The pillow features a bouncy, resilient foam structure that maintains its shape impressively well even after hours of pressure. The exterior material is notably breathable, preventing the heat buildup that often plagues soft, foam-based sleep aids.
Integrating the pillow into my daily routine was seamless, as it arrives ready to use right out of the box. While the shape takes a night or two to get used to, the ergonomic benefits for my neck were noticeable almost immediately.
This pillow is a fantastic choice for stomach sleepers who require targeted head and neck support that traditional rectangular pillows simply cannot provide.
